Go Fishing Like An Egret

Stay still and look. Be patient.
If you see a fish swim by, grab it quickly!
You must not hesitate! It is all in the beak.


Soon, you will be rewarded with a fish.


To maneuver the fish so you can swallow it, twist your head back and forth while manipulating the fish with your beak until it is in the perfect vertical position.


This manipulation might take many tries. It is especially difficult if your fish fights back.
I almost had it vertically here.


Gulp!
Alas, I am successful and the fish is in me now.
This fishing is hard work. I am already hungry again!
